2025 French Open Highlights
In a remarkable conclusion to the 2025 French Open, tennis champions Coco Gauff and Carlos Alcaraz emerged victorious in tense finals held at the iconic Roland-Garros venue over the weekend.
Women’s Singles Final
Gauff, the rising star from the United States, triumphed against **Belarus’s Aryna Sabalenka** in a gripping three-set match, securing the women’s singles title with scores of 6-7(5), 6-2, 6-4.
Men’s Singles Final
On the men’s side, Spain’s Alcaraz battled it out in an epic five-set match against Jannik Sinner, enduring a marathon that lasted five hours and 29 minutes, ultimately winning 4-6, 6-7, 6-4, 7-6, 7-6. This match not only showcased the skill and tenacity of both players but also set a record as the longest final in the history of the tournament.
Record Attendance
In the aftermath of these extraordinary performances, the French Open team made a noteworthy announcement. They revealed that this year’s event set a new record for attendance, drawing a remarkable 685,000 spectators over its duration, an historic achievement for the tournament. The news was shared on the French Open’s official Instagram page, which celebrated the record turnout with the post,
“Record numbers on and off the court.”
